Grub avoidance and control are vital for safeguarding lawns from the damage brought on by beetle larvae feeding upon grassroots. Early detection is crucial-- indications consist of brown patches that lift easily from the soil or an increase in birds and other wildlife digging for grubs. Preventive treatments, used at the right time in the grub life process, can substantially reduce problems These treatments may be chemical or biological, such as advantageous nematodes that naturally lower grub populations. For active invasions, alleviative products can be applied, though they are most reliable when grubs are little and actively feeding. A proactive method, including correct lawn upkeep, aeration, and overseeding, helps in reducing the likelihood of extreme grub issues. Healthy lawns recover more quickly from damage and are less prone to repeating infestations.
